Crestron C2N-RTHS Remote Temperature/Humidity Sensor
Physical Description
Refer to the following illustrations.
The face of the sensor is 1.5 in (3.81 cm) in diameter, and has an LED and
pinhole access for the TSID button. The sensor body is 2.0 in (5.64 cm)
long, and mounts nearly flush to the wall.
The C2N-RTHS remote sensor is contained in a cylindrical plastic body.
It mounts in a one-inch diameter hole, exposing a 1.5 in (3.81 cm)
diameter disk that protrudes approximately 0.2 inch (0.5 cm) from the
surface of the wall. Total mounting depth is about 2.25 in (5.72 cm).
Front and Angled Views
Rear and Angled Views
NOTE: The face of the unit may be painted or papered over. Ensure that
paint does not enter (or wall paper cover) the perimeter gap or the holes
for the TSID button and LED.
